Uncertainty Over Complainant's Identity in APC Secretary General Case – Ady Macauley The ongoing legal proceedings against Lansana Dumbuya, National Secretary General of the All People’s Congress (APC), are drawing scrutiny due to the undisclosed identity of the complainant. During an appearance on Liberty Online TV, Ady Macauley, an APC flagbearer aspirant and legal analyst, suggested that the ambiguity surrounding the complaint raises concerns about potential political bias
